show aaa accounting
Displays information about accounting servers configured for Authenticated Switch Access. Accounting
servers keep track of network resources (time, packets, bytes, etc.) and user activity.

Usage Guidelines
Use the show aaa accounting command to display accounting servers configured for management session
types (Telnet, FTP, console port, HTTP, or SNMP)l.
